1. EXAM OVERVIEW & KEY INFORMATION
What Is the R-30 Masonry Contractor License?
The Arizona R-30 Masonry Contractor License is issued by the Arizona Registrar of Contractors
(ROC). It authorizes the holder to perform masonry work including brick, block, stone, and
concrete masonry unit (CMU) construction on residential structures. The R-30 license is a
residential specialty classification.

2. SECTION 1: MASONRY MATERIALS & PROPERTIES (Questions 1-40)
Q1. Which ASTM specification governs the requirements for Type M mortar used in
load-bearing masonry?
A) ASTM C176
B) ASTM C270
C) ASTM C780
D) ASTM C150
Answer: B
Rationale: ASTM C270 defines the classification, composition, and performance of Type M, S,
N, and O mortars, with Type M being the strongest and suitable for load-bearing applications.

Q3. What is the minimum compressive strength of Type S mortar?
A) 1,200 psi
B) 1,800 psi
C) 2,500 psi
D) 3,000 psi
Answer: B
Rationale: Type S mortar, commonly specified for structural masonry, has a minimum
compressive strength of 1,800 psi when properly cured.
Q4. Which of the following materials is most commonly used as mortar in masonry work?
A) Pure cement
B) Lime only
C) Portland cement, lime, and sand
D) Epoxy cement
Answer: C
Rationale: Standard masonry mortar consists of Portland cement, hydrated lime, and sand to
balance strength and workability.
